#include "tensorflow/core/framework/common_shape_fns.h"
#include "tensorflow/core/framework/op.h"

namespace tensorflow {

// TODO(saeta): Add support for setting ClientOptions values.
REGISTER_OP("BigtableClient")
    .Attr("project_id: string")
    .Attr("instance_id: string")
    .Attr("connection_pool_size: int")
    .Attr("max_receive_message_size: int = -1")
    .Attr("container: string = ''")
    .Attr("shared_name: string = ''")
    .Output("client: resource")
    .SetShapeFn(shape_inference::ScalarShape);

// TODO(saeta): Add support for Application Profiles.
// See https://cloud.google.com/bigtable/docs/app-profiles for more info.
REGISTER_OP("BigtableTable")
    .Input("client: resource")
    .Attr("table_name: string")
    .Attr("container: string = ''")
    .Attr("shared_name: string = ''")
    .Output("table: resource")
    .SetShapeFn(shape_inference::ScalarShape);

REGISTER_OP("DatasetToBigtable")
    .Input("table: resource")
    .Input("input_dataset: variant")
    .Input("column_families: string")
    .Input("columns: string")
    .Input("timestamp: int64")
    .SetShapeFn(shape_inference::NoOutputs);

REGISTER_OP("BigtableLookupDataset")
    .Input("keys_dataset: variant")
    .Input("table: resource")
    .Input("column_families: string")
    .Input("columns: string")
    .Output("handle: variant")
    .SetShapeFn(shape_inference::ScalarShape);

REGISTER_OP("BigtablePrefixKeyDataset")
    .Input("table: resource")
    .Input("prefix: string")
    .Output("handle: variant")
    .SetIsStateful()  // TODO(b/65524810): Source dataset ops must be marked
                      // stateful to inhibit constant folding.
    .SetShapeFn(shape_inference::ScalarShape);

REGISTER_OP("BigtableRangeKeyDataset")
    .Input("table: resource")
    .Input("start_key: string")
    .Input("end_key: string")
    .Output("handle: variant")
    .SetIsStateful()  // TODO(b/65524810): Source dataset ops must be marked
                      // stateful to inhibit constant folding.
    .SetShapeFn(shape_inference::ScalarShape);

REGISTER_OP("BigtableSampleKeysDataset")
    .Input("table: resource")
    .Output("handle: variant")
    .SetIsStateful()  // TODO(b/65524810): Source dataset ops must be marked
                      // stateful to inhibit constant folding.
    .SetShapeFn(shape_inference::ScalarShape);

REGISTER_OP("BigtableSampleKeyPairsDataset")
    .Input("table: resource")
    .Input("prefix: string")
    .Input("start_key: string")
    .Input("end_key: string")
    .Output("handle: variant")
    .SetIsStateful()  // TODO(b/65524810): Source dataset ops must be marked
                      // stateful to inhibit constant folding.
    .SetShapeFn(shape_inference::ScalarShape);

// TODO(saeta): Support continuing despite bad data (e.g. empty string, or
// skip incomplete row.)
REGISTER_OP("BigtableScanDataset")
    .Input("table: resource")
    .Input("prefix: string")
    .Input("start_key: string")
    .Input("end_key: string")
    .Input("column_families: string")
    .Input("columns: string")
    .Input("probability: float")
    .Output("handle: variant")
    .SetIsStateful()  // TODO(b/65524810): Source dataset ops must be marked
                      // stateful to inhibit constant folding.
    .SetShapeFn(shape_inference::ScalarShape);

}  // namespace tensorflow
